NeighborWorks® Boise's Homebuyer Education course is ideal for homebuyers who will be purchasing within one year or are currently in escrow.Key information on budgeting, credit lending, real estate, inspections, insurance, and down payment programs are presented.
The monthly 6-hour course is held in-person.
The course is led by a HUD-certified counselor and industry professionals. The course material covers:
- Budgeting
- Understanding Credit
- Home Ownership Readiness
- Available Loans
- Shopping for a Home
- Purchasing Costs
- Hiring a Home Inspector
- Closing Process
